That bloody Clip! It is one of the two fastenings holding the centre compartment in place. You have get it out to get at the battery. See p114. It's been discussed elsewhere. I don't know why Honda didn't use two screws.
Reply
#13
The clip is a push pin clip. You push the center in to release it, then back the center out some, push the clip back in the hole, and push the pin back down to lock it in. I dont know why Honda put that in there. The screw will hold the tol tray in there just fine, as a matter of fact with the seat on, it couldnt go anywhere if there were NO screws or push pins holding it in.

As far as the battery goes, there should be a strap around it they were supposed to leave on in set up to aid in pulling the battery out and sliding it back in.
